/**
|
|
* The SQL table this class stores sessions in, called <tt>SESSIONS</tt>,
|
|
* looks like this:
|
|
*
|
|
* <blockquote><pre>
|
|
* TABLE SESSIONS (
|
|
* ID VARBINARY(32) PRIMARY KEY UNIQUE NOT NULL,
|
|
* CREATED TIMESTAMP NOT NULL,
|
|
* LAST_ACCESSED TIMESTAMP NOT NULL,
|
|
* PROTOCOL VARCHAR(7) NOT NULL,
|
|
* SUITE VARCHAR(255) NOT NULL,
|
|
* PEER_HOST TEXT NOT NULL,
|
|
* PEER_CERT_TYPE VARCHAR(32),
|
|
* PEER_CERTS BLOB,
|
|
* CERT_TYPE VARCHAR(32),
|
|
* CERTS BLOB,
|
|
* SECRET VARBINARY(48) NOT NULL
|
|
* )
|
|
* </pre></blockquote>
|
|
*
|
|
* <p>Note that the master secret for sessions is not protected before
|
|
* being inserted into the database; it is up to the system to protect
|
|
* the stored data from unauthorized access.
|
|
*/
